BURNING WITCHES, an all-female- power metal band from Switzerland, to play a special show at Old Roseville’s Goldfield Trading Post. December 17.

Although there are only 10 dates on Burning Witches’ abbreviated US tour, the buzz created by their latest album on Napalm Records, ‘The Dark Tower,’ is undeniable. Roseville is one of the last shows on the docket and, more than likely, the only chance Sacramentans will be able to see them for the foreseeable future.


For the better part of 8 years, these metal maidens have flown the flag for DIY heavy metal bands by releasing their debut self-titled record in 2017 through crowd-funding efforts on Pledge Music. Even without the help of a reputable label, the band managed to land at #73 on the Swiss charts. Their hard work would soon pay off and land them a coveted record deal with Nuclear Blast where they released 3 full-lengths and two extended plays.

For those lucky enough to catch the band in 2022 on their first US tour with the all-female Iron Maiden tribute, The Iron Maidens, the upcoming show seems like the perfect bookend for 2023.

Musically the band has drawn comparisons to such disparate heritage acts as Iron Maiden, Alice Cooper, Judas Priest and Accept. Upon further inspection, it seems there are many other heavy metal acts that could be referenced on ‘The Dark Tower’ such as Warlock and W.A.S.P. (the band even included “I Wanna Be Somebody on its latest). Standout tracks from the 2023 release include “Arrow Of Time,” “Heart Of Ice,” and the furiously-paced “Unleash The Beast.”

Since forming in 2015, they’ve amassed quite the following both at home and abroad. Today the band is anchored by original members Romana Kalkuhl (guitars), Jeanine Grob (bass), Lala Frischknecht (drums), and rounded out by mainstays Laura Goldemond (lead vocals) and Larissa Ernst (guitars).
